COMMERCIAL.

LONDON MARKETS. Messrs Dalgety and Co., Ltd., report having received the following cable from their London House under date of the 24th November: Tallow: 2300 casks offered, 600 casks sold. On the average prices are lower by 7/ per cwt. Prime mutton 62/ to 63/; gut 40/." • FEILDING CATTLE FAIR. Abraham and Williams Ltd. report: At the Supplementary Cattle Fair held at Feilding dn the 26th inst., a good yarding came forward. There was a good attendance of the public, but bidding was poor right through the sale, most of the grown cattle being turned out unsold. We quote Forward heifers to £ll 10/, 2yr steers to £7 5/, 20-month dairy heifers £6 to £6 6/, 20-months dairy heifers r.w.b to £6 12/6, small dairy heifers £2 19/ to £4, yearling S.H. steers to £4.
